Everyday Life Creativity Examples (3): Kitchen

Sharma, June 18, 2025June 19, 2025

I’m excited to show you how the kitchen can become a playground of imagination and problem-solving! 🍽️🧠🎨

Here are 5 fun and innovative examples of creativity in kitchen problem solving — served with a smile! 😊🍲✨


🟢 Example 1: No Fancy Tools or Equipment

❓ What is the Problem?

Sometimes we don’t have tools like a blender, cookie cutter, or rolling pin. 🥄 This can delay cooking or make tasks harder.

🌟 Why is it Important?

Lack of equipment shouldn’t stop the joy of cooking. 🎉 Finding alternatives builds confidence and problem-solving skills. 🧠💪

💡 Creative Solution in 3 Steps:

  1. 🍾 Use a clean glass bottle as a rolling pin or pestle for grinding.
  2. 🧃 Cut cookie shapes using the rim of a steel glass or jar lid!
  3. 🎨 Let kids invent their own “tools” using foil, spoons, or chopsticks — learning becomes an adventure! 🕵️‍♀️

🔵 Example 2: Leftover Food That No One Wants to Eat

❓ What is the Problem?

Leftovers like rice, chapati, or veggies often go uneaten and are wasted. ❌🥘 Kids especially don’t enjoy reheated food.

🌟 Why is it Important?

Reducing food waste saves money and respects resources. 🌍 Making leftovers exciting also builds appreciation for food. 💚

💡 Creative Solution in 3 Steps:

  1. 🍕 Transform leftovers — rice into fried rice balls, chapati into wraps or pizza, veggies into cutlets.
  2. 🎭 Name them fun things like “Magic Rolls” or “Rainbow Bites” to get kids curious and excited. 🧙‍♂️
  3. 📸 Start a “Leftover Challenge” once a week where family members create and vote on the best leftover makeover! 🏆

🔴 Example 3: Picky Eaters in the Family

❓ What is the Problem?

Some children or adults avoid certain foods like vegetables or pulses. 🥦 They complain or leave the food on the plate.

🌟 Why is it Important?

Balanced nutrition is key for health and growth. 🧠🥗 Creative presentation can turn “yuck” into “yum!” 😋

💡 Creative Solution in 3 Steps:

  1. 🖌️ Turn boring veggies into smiley faces, shapes, or food art in the plate.
  2. 📚 Tell a mini story around the meal — like “Super Potato saves the day with protein power!” 🦸‍♀️🥔
  3. 🍡 Hide the disliked item in new forms — beetroot paratha, spinach muffins, lentil pancakes — make them fun and tasty! 🎨

🟠 Example 4: Running Out of Ingredients Mid-Recipe

❓ What is the Problem?

Sometimes while cooking, we realize we don’t have a key ingredient. 😱 This creates panic or ruins the recipe.

🌟 Why is it Important?

Staying calm and creative in the kitchen is a valuable life skill. 🧘 It teaches us adaptability and resourcefulness. 🛠️

💡 Creative Solution in 3 Steps:

  1. 🔄 Use smart swaps — no curd? Use lemon and milk. No breadcrumbs? Use crushed cornflakes or poha.
  2. 📞 Make it a family “Kitchen Puzzle” — ask everyone for substitute ideas and experiment together! 🧩
  3. ✍️ Keep a “Swap Book” in the kitchen — write down tried-and-loved replacements for future use! 📒

🟣 Example 5: Kitchen Mess After Cooking with Kids

❓ What is the Problem?

Cooking with children is fun but leads to spills, messes, and sticky counters. 🍫🎨 Cleaning becomes a tiring task afterward.

🌟 Why is it Important?

A clean space is healthy and teaches discipline. 🧼 Turning cleaning into a playful task can reduce stress and teach responsibility. 🧽❤️

💡 Creative Solution in 3 Steps:

  1. 🎶 Create a “Clean-Up Song” that everyone sings while tidying up — make it short and fun!
  2. 🧽 Turn wiping and organizing into a game: “Who can clean the fastest without leaving a spot?”
  3. 🧺 Let kids design their own apron and mini cleaning kits — make them feel like kitchen superheroes! 🦸‍♂️🦸‍♀️

🍽️ The kitchen is more than a place for cooking — it’s a lab of love, learning, and laughter!
Creativity adds spice to every slice of life! 🌈✨
